About this study

The purpose of the current study will be to evaluate the usefulness of 68Ga-HA-DOTATATE compared to current standard anatomical imaging including CT, MRI, 111 In-pentetreotide Scans, 18F-FDG PET/CT, as available. Specifically, we aim to assess the utility of 68Ga-HA-DOTATATE in primary workup of neuroendocrine tumours, including suspected neuroendocrine tumours that do not have a cross-sectional imaging correlate. An additional aim is to assess the role of 68Ga-HA-DOTATATE in surveillance of completely resected neuroendocrine tumours, which is a point of disagreement amongst current society guidelines . Finally, we will assess utility of 68Ga-HA-DOTATATE for localization of functioning neuroendocrine tumors including insulinoma and gastrinoma.

Inclusion criteria

  • Male or female. If female of child-bearing potential and outside of the window of 10 days since the last menstrual period, a negative pregnancy test will be required.
  • Age greater than or equal to 18 years.
  • Able and willing to follow instructions and comply with the protocol.
  • Provide written informed consent prior to participation in the study.
  • Clinically suspected (patients presenting with symptom(s) suggestive of carcinoid syndrome or biochemically suggestive of Neuroendocrine Tumor) or Biopsy proven Neuroendocrine Tumor

Exclusion criteria

  • Nursing or pregnant females.
  • Age less than 18 years.
  • Surgery in the area of interest within the preceding 2 months.

Treatment and study plan

68Ga-HA-DOTATATE PET/CT imaging

Diagnostic Test

Each patient will receive an IV injection 68Ga-HA-DOTATATE. Imaging will be conducted beginning 45-90 minutes after an injection of between 100-250 MBq 68Ga-HA-DOTATATE in patients.

  • After the 68Ga-HA-DOTATATE acquisition is complete, a CT scan will be performed for attenuation correction and localization in the same in line gantry without patient movement between the two scans.
  • The results of the 68Ga-HA-DOTATATE PET/CT will be compared to any prior imaging and pathologic results.

Primary outcomes

  1. 68Ga-HA-DOTATATE PET/CT imaging

    Time frame: 5 years

    To compare 68Ga-HA-DOTATATE PET/CT imaging at identifying somatostatin positive tumors to conventional imaging [including CT, MRI, 111 In-pentetreotide Scans, 18F-FDG PET/CT, as available]. 68Ga-HA-DOTATATE PET/CT scans will be evaluated for abnormal accumulation of 68Ga-HA-DOTATATE. Any abnormal uptake will be determined for up to 5 lesions and compared to results of standard of care imaging performed [including CT, MRI, 111 In-pentetreotide (OctreoscanTM) Scan with SPECT/CT, 18F-FDG PET/CT, as available] for presence/absence of each lesion. Comparison to any follow up 68Ga-HA-DOTATATE PET/CT Scans will also be performed (up to 5 follow up68Ga-HA-DOTATATE PET/CT Scans will be allowed).
